Follow these steps to safely connect batteries in series: The positive (+) terminal of one battery is connected to the negative (-) terminal of the next battery. There are two ways to wire batteries together, parallel and series. The illustrations below show how these set wiring variations can produce different voltage and amp hour outputs.
